Abstract

A method and radio in a network node for passive intermodulation (PIM) downlink subspace acquisition. According to one aspect, a method includes determining a downlink projection matrix that is formed using the downlink beamforming weights and determining a first downlink interference covariance matrix estimate for a current downlink orthogonal frequency division multiplexed, OFDM, symbol based at least in part on multiplying the downlink projection matrix by a scaling factor that is dependent on the passive intermodulation, PIM, power generated in one or more uplink channels.
